Required Qualifications:

Some post-secondary education.

Additional Required Qualifications:

Completion of post-secondary education (e.g. Course(s) in office of business administration, medical office assistant, or unit clerk diploma is required. The successful applicant must be familiar with and extremely skilled with the use of computers. Experience with the following is required: Microsoft Office Suite with an advanced knowledge of Outlook/Calendar, e-People including experience with Manager services (timekeeping, RMS, and delegate roles), Markview, IProcurement iExpense, Grand & Toy ordering, IT requests (IT Service Hub & IAM) Microsoft Teams, ARI-insights & Financial Services, Adobe Acrobat Reader, and Data Group. Highly developed communication skills, Organization skills. customer service skills, interpersonal skills and problem-solving skills are essential to this position. The successful candidate must also have previous experience and knowledge of functional cost center strings, timekeeping codes, collective agreements and assisting with the process of hiring. The successful candidate must also have the ability to work independently and with frequent interruptions. Candidate must also be familiar working within Excel spread sheets.

Preferred Qualifications:

Previous experience with the following: arranging and scheduling interviews for job postings, requesting accesses, software and cell phones for new employees, payroll, data entry, submitting orders and managing inventory, managing and processing involves, maintaining and managing filing, managing various Outlook calendars and completing/ submitting forms electronically.
